
- Use compiler-rt and picolibc instead of avr-libc. - Use ld.lld instead of avr-ld (or avr-gcc). This makes it much easier to get started with TinyGo on AVR because installing these extra tools (gcc-avr, avr-libc) can be a hassle. It also opens the door for future improvements such as ThinLTO. There is a code size increase but I think it's worth it in the long run. The code size increase can hopefully be reduced with improvements to the LLVM AVR backend and to compiler-rt.
